**UPDATE** (Feb. 2016) - Janet has become a great puppy and learned a lot in her foster home. She plays well with her foster dog sisters and is respectful when they have had enough. She is house-trained and crate trained but can now also be left out of the crate when her foster parents aren't home. She has never chewed on anything she wasn't supposed to, only chewing on her toys. She is spayed, microchipped, and up to date on vaccines. She is still working on learning to walk on a leash but is getting better each time. Janet is quite calm for her age and at only 40 lbs. she is a great size for any home! She knows sit and is working on other commands. She likes treats but one of her favorites is ice cubes right from the freezer.
